What is cis-trans isomerism Class 11?
The stereoisomerism arising due to restricted rotation of bonds is called cis-trans isomerism. The isomer which has similar groups on the same side of the double bond is called cis isomer and the isomer which has same groups on the opposite side of the double bond and is known as trans form. 177 Views.
Are cis isomers polar?
Cis isomers are molecules with the same connectivity of atoms. They feature similar side groups placed on the same side of a double bond. Trans isomers feature molecules with similar side groups placed on opposite sides of a double bond. Cis isomers are almost always polar.

What are cis and trans isomers of maleic acid?
Maleic acid is the cis isomer and fumaric acid is the trans isomer. Elaidic acid and oleic acid are cis-trans isomers. The former is solid at room temperature (melting point = 43 oC) and the latter is found to be liquid, with a melting point of 13.4 o.
